A flash flood watch will remain in effect until 3 am Sunday morning for all of El Paso County and Teller County.
Storms will continue to bring heavy rain into the Pikes Peak region through late tonight. These storms are slow movers and will drop up to an inch or more of rain in one hour. Storms will break down around midnight, but some showers may stick around during the overnight hours. More heavy rain is in the forecast for Sunday and again on Monday.
